Bug Tracker

Changes between Version 1 and Version 2 of Ticket #11060, comment 10


Ignore:
Timestamp:
Jul 15, 2013, 1:59:03 PM (9 years ago)
Author:
Rick Waldron
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#11060, comment 10

    v1 v2  
    1717This is already fixed, please upgrade your version of jQuery.
    1818
    19 JavaScript numbers are IEEE standard #754, double-precision binary floating-point 64-bit numbers. This means that only even numbers greater then (2^53) are representable. jQuery had enough bug report/complaints about larger numbers (eg. 201319611370584515) being rounded that the only solution was to use a string to represent data values that were not representable as numbers. This way you get the actual value, despite the type being incorrect.
     19JavaScript numbers are IEEE standard 754, double-precision binary floating-point 64-bit numbers. This means that only even numbers greater then (2^53) are representable. jQuery had enough bug report/complaints about larger numbers (eg. 201319611370584515) being rounded that the only solution was to use a string to represent data values that were not representable as numbers. This way you get the actual value, despite the type being incorrect.